Transaction 4de91a66041090504c096db9056e68af7812145751b2e8e11b49101ac2d211e5
1 Input
2 Outputs
- 4de91a66041090504c096db9056e68af7812145751b2e8e11b49101ac2d211e5:0
- 4de91a66041090504c096db9056e68af7812145751b2e8e11b49101ac2d211e5:1
value 4830000
address 1QESoRwEy6V9G42RVuPAGLconeN61v5vYa
value 21859916
address 1HFVHCQZ8Kvuh9Dgah7G6L5Nd9bSF3RYdC